O que são temas do WordPress

Leitura de 2 minutos
2026-03-13
2026-06-04
2,291
Eu recebo uma comissão quando você faz compras através dos links abaixo, sem custo adicional para você.

Na construção do mundo digital, o WordPress se tornou a base de inúmeros websites devido à sua flexibilidade e facilidade de uso. O componente central que dá a esses websites uma aparência e uma personalidade únicas são os temas do WordPress. Um tema é um conjunto de arquivos que trabalham em conjunto para definir a apresentação visual do website, incluindo a estrutura do layout, o design, os estilos de formatação e algumas funções interativas. Em outras palavras, o tema é a ponte que liga os dados do backend do website (como artigos e páginas) à interface que os visitantes veem; ele determina a forma como o conteúdo é exibido, sem alterar o conteúdo em si.

O conteúdo do site é armazenado em um banco de dados independente, enquanto os temas funcionam como um conjunto de “skins” ou “capas” que podem ser trocados a qualquer momento. Isso significa que você pode alternar entre diferentes temas a qualquer hora para mudar completamente a aparência do site, sem preocupações de que dados essenciais, como artigos e comentários dos usuários, sejam perdidos. Essa separação entre o conteúdo e a apresentação é a chave para a grande flexibilidade do WordPress. Seja para criar um blog pessoal simples, um site corporativo completo ou uma loja online repleta de produtos, você consegue encontrar ou desenvolver um tema que corresponda ao design desejado.

A estrutura central dos temas do WordPress.

Um tema WordPress completo é composto por vários tipos de arquivos, cada um com uma função específica, que juntos formam a interface frontal do site. Compreender esses arquivos essenciais é fundamental para a personalização e o desenvolvimento de temas.

Leitura recomendada Aprenda a desenvolver temas do WordPress do zero: um guia essencial para criar um site personalizado.

Arquivos de estilo e índice essenciais

Cada tópico deve conter dois arquivos básicos:style.css e index.phpstyle.css A função do arquivo vai muito além de ser apenas um simples arquivo de estilo. A sua parte inicial (cabeçalho) contém uma informação de comentário especial, e é através da leitura dessa informação que o WordPress reconhece os metadados do tema: nome do tema, autor, descrição, versão e licença. Todas as regras principais de estilo CSS do tema também são geralmente definidas neste arquivo.

Hospedagem para sites WordPress da UltraHost
Garantia de reembolso em 30 dias, largura de banda ilimitada e banco de dados, proteção contra DDoS gratuita; desconto de 50% na compra de 3 anos (planos de 4 TB a 10 TB).

index.php Este é o arquivo do modelo principal de todo o site e representa a última linha de defesa na estrutura de modelos do WordPress. Quando o sistema não consegue encontrar um arquivo de modelo mais específico que corresponda ao conteúdo da solicitação atual (por exemplo, quando não há um modelo projetado especificamente para uma determinada categoria de página), ele utiliza este modelo por padrão. index.php É usado para renderizar a página. Ele define a estrutura básica de saída da área de conteúdo da página.

Arquivos de modelo para diferentes áreas da página de controle

Um tema com estrutura clara divide a página em diferentes módulos, que são geridos por arquivos de template específicos.header.php Os arquivos geralmente contêm uma declaração do tipo de documento e o código HTML. <head> A área (que contém etiquetas meta, títulos e estilos de scripts introduzidos), bem como o logotipo da marca, o menu de navegação e outros conteúdos do cabeçal comum localizados no topo do site. Em outros modelos, isso é obtido através da chamada de… get_header() A função pode simplesmente incluir essa parte inicial (header).

Da mesma forma,footer.php O arquivo define a área inferior do site, que geralmente contém informações de copyright, links adicionais, etc. Isso pode ser configurado através de… get_footer() Introdução de funções.sidebar.php Isso define a área da barra lateral, utilizada para a colocação de ferramentas adicionais (widgets). Graças a esse design modular, é possível aumentar significativamente a reutilizabilidade e a manutenibilidade do código.

O arquivo central que expande a funcionalidade do tema

functions.php É o “cérebro” do tema e o centro de expansão de suas funcionalidades. Este arquivo é carregado automaticamente durante a inicialização do tema. Os desenvolvedores podem adicionar várias novas funcionalidades ao tema aqui, como: definir a posição dos menus de navegação, criar áreas para gadgets, adicionar tipos de artigos ou categorias personalizadas, incorporar arquivos JavaScript e CSS, e utilizar os diversos ganchos de ação (action hooks) e filtros do WordPress para modificar o comportamento padrão do sistema. Este arquivo não serve para exibir conteúdo diretamente, mas sim para aprimorar ou alterar as funcionalidades do tema e do próprio WordPress.

Leitura recomendada Do desenvolvimento à implantação: como construir e otimizar um tema WordPress de nível profissional.

// 在 functions.php 中注册一个菜单位置
function mytheme_register_menus() {
    register_nav_menus(
        array(
            'primary-menu' => __( '主导航菜单' ),
            'footer-menu'  => __( '页脚菜单' ),
        )
    );
}
add_action( 'init', 'mytheme_register_menus' );

Mecanismo de funcionamento do tema: Estrutura hierárquica dos templates

O WordPress utiliza um sistema inteligente chamado “estrutura hierárquica de templates” para determinar qual arquivo de template deve ser usado para renderizar qualquer solicitação de página. Essa lógica garante que o conteúdo seja exibido da maneira mais apropriada.

Processo de decisão com estrutura hierárquica

Quando um usuário visita um endereço da web, o WordPress primeiro determina o tipo da solicitação (se é um único artigo, uma página, uma lista de artigos dentro de uma categoria ou os resultados de uma pesquisa). Em seguida, procura o arquivo de template correspondente seguindo uma lista de prioridades predefinida, que vai do mais específico para o mais geral.

Por exemplo, quando se acessa a página de um artigo específico, o WordPress procura na seguinte ordem:single-{post-type}-{slug}.php -> single-{post-type}.php -> single.php -> singular.php -> index.phpEle usará o primeiro arquivo que for encontrado. Esse design permite que os desenvolvedores criem modelos únicos para tipos de conteúdo muito específicos (por exemplo, um tipo de artigo personalizado chamado “Projeto” ou um artigo específico), alcançando assim um design altamente personalizado.

hospedagem compartilhada da hosting.com
Alto desempenho com CPUs AMD EPYC, armazenamento SSD NVMe e LiteSpeed, suporte interno especializado 24 horas por dia, 7 dias por semana, medidas de segurança avançadas, incluindo SSL, força bruta, malware e proteção contra DDoS, economia de até 73%

Arquivos de modelos comuns e suas funções

Além dos arquivos principais mencionados anteriormente, os arquivos de modelo comuns em um tema também incluem:page.php Usado para renderizar páginas independentes;archive.php Usado para exibir listas de arquivos de artigos (como categorias, etiquetas, listas de artigos de autores);search.php Usado para exibir os resultados da pesquisa;404.php Usado para exibir a mensagem de erro “Página não encontrada”.front-page.php Pode ser usado para personalizar a exibição da página inicial do site. Compreender a posição desses arquivos na estrutura hierárquica é fundamental para o desenvolvimento eficaz de temas (temas visuais do site).

Como personalizar um tema de forma segura?

Modificar diretamente os arquivos fonte de um tema já instalado é perigoso, pois as atualizações do tema podem substituir todas as alterações feitas. Por isso, a comunidade do WordPress recomenda várias métodos personalizados seguros e sustentáveis.

Criar e usar subtemas

Um subtema é um tema que herda todas as funcionalidades e estilos de um tema pai. Isso permite que você modifique ou adicione apenas as partes necessárias, sem precisar alterar o tema pai em si. Esta é a maneira mais recomendada e profissional de personalizar temas. Criar um subtema é muito simples: basta… /wp-content/themes/ Crie uma nova pasta no diretório e, em seguida, dentro dela, crie outro arquivo. style.css Arquivo, e no cabeçalho do arquivo, através de… Template O campo indica o nome do diretório do tópico pai.

Leitura recomendada Guia Definitivo do Tailwind CSS: Construindo Páginas Web Responsivas e Modernas do Zero

/*
Theme Name:  我的自定义子主题
Template:    twentytwentyfour
*/

Depois disso, você pode criar um arquivo com o mesmo nome que o tema pai no diretório dos subtemas (por exemplo, para fazer modificações). header.php ou page.phpNo WordPress, a versão contida no subtema é utilizada com prioridade. O mesmo ocorre com o CSS: a versão definida no subtema prevalece sobre a versão definida no tema principal. style.css Será carregado após a tabela de estilos do tema pai, facilitando a sobreposição de estilos.

Utilizando ferramentas e plugins integrados

Para iniciantes ou ajustes simples que não envolvem código, o “Customizer” (localizado em “Aparência” -> “Personalizar”) que vem com o WordPress é uma ferramenta excelente. Ele oferece uma pré-visualização em tempo real, permitindo que você modifique diretamente o logotipo do site, as cores, os menus, o layout dos widgets, etc., e ainda permite salvar essas alterações no banco de dados ou no tema. customize.css Médio.

Hospedagem Compartilhada InterServer
Hospedagem compartilhada $2.50 USD por mês, primeiro mês $0.1 USD código promocional tryinterserver, 461 scripts de aplicativos em nuvem, instalação com um clique.

Além disso, muitos temas disponibilizam um painel detalhado de “Opções do Tema”, que permite ajustar o layout, o formato e as funcionalidades através de uma interface gráfica. Para adicionar funcionalidades mais complexas, é possível instalar plugins independentes. Isso mantém a simplicidade do tema e permite que as funcionalidades sejam preservadas ao trocar de tema.

resumos

Os temas do WordPress não são apenas um conjunto de ferramentas para embelezar um site; eles representam um sistema completo composto por arquivos de modelo, tabelas de estilo e extensões de funcionalidades. Eles permitem uma correspondência inteligente entre o conteúdo e a forma como este é exibido, através de uma estrutura hierárquica de modelos, alcançando assim uma separação perfeita entre o conteúdo e o design. Seja através da criação de subtemas para desenvolvimento avançado ou do uso de ferramentas de personalização para ajustes visuais, compreender o funcionamento dos temas é essencial para construir sites WordPress personalizados e de alto desempenho. Ao entender isso, você poderá realmente aproveitar todo o potencial do WordPress.

Perguntas frequentes Perguntas frequentes

Qual é a diferença entre temas e plugins do WordPress?

O tema controla principalmente a aparência e o layout do site (ou seja, a forma como é exibido no lado cliente), sendo responsável por definir “como o conteúdo é apresentado”. Os plugins, por sua vez, são utilizados para adicionar ou expandir funcionalidades ao site (tanto no lado cliente quanto no lado servidor), como a criação de formulários de contato, a otimização para mecanismos de busca (SEO), a criação de lojas online, etc., e são responsáveis por determinar “o que o site é capaz de fazer”. É possível ativar vários plugins em um único site, mas geralmente apenas um tema pode estar ativado de cada vez.

Depois de trocar o tema, o layout e as configurações do site vão ficar desordenados?

Isso depende da compatibilidade do novo tema e do grau de personalização que você fez. O conteúdo principal (artigos, páginas) não será perdido. No entanto, os módulos de conteúdo criados com funcionalidades ou códigos específicos do tema antigo podem não ser exibidos corretamente. Além disso, a posição dos menus, as configurações da área de ferramentas, os elementos do cabeçalho e do rodapé, entre outros, geralmente precisam ser reconfigurados no novo tema, pois diferentes temas têm definições e níveis de suporte diferentes para essas áreas.

O que é um tema responsivo e por que é essencial?

Um tema responsivo é um tipo de design de página da web que consegue se adaptar automaticamente a diferentes tamanhos de tela (desde computadores de mesa até celulares). Ele utiliza técnicas como consultas de mídia CSS para ajustar dinamicamente o layout, o tamanho das imagens e o estilo da navegação de acordo com a largura da tela do dispositivo visitante, garantindo uma boa experiência de uso em todos os dispositivos. Até o ano de 2026, o tráfego vindo de dispositivos móveis já assumiu uma posição dominante, e ter um tema responsivo é essencial para aumentar a retenção de usuários e melhorar o posicionamento nos mecanismos de busca.

Como julgar a qualidade de um tópico?

É possível avaliar um tema de várias maneiras: Primeiro, verifique a qualidade do seu código, se ele segue os padrões de codificação do WordPress e se não é excessivamente redundante ou complexo; em seguida, observe a frequência de atualizações e as avaliações dos usuários – temas que não são atualizados há muito tempo ou que recebem muitas críticas negativas apresentam um risco maior; depois, teste o desempenho do tema, utilizando ferramentas de medição de velocidade para verificar a velocidade de carregamento do seu site de demonstração; por fim, confira a compatibilidade com diferentes navegadores e dispositivos móveis, além de verificar se os documentos e canais de suporte do tema são completos.